Man, woman found dead in Anantnag

Srinagar: A man and a girl, who were reported missing around two weeks ago, were found dead under mysterious circumstances on Monday in south Kashmir’s Anantnag, officials said.

The bodies were recovered from an abandoned house in Kamad in the Dialgam area of the district, the officials said.

They said the deceased have been identified as local residents of Anantnag district — Muntasir Shafi Lone, 25, and a suspected minor girl.

The duo was reported missing around two weeks ago and their semi-decomposed bodies were found by the locals Monday, the officials said.

A forensic team has been rushed to the spot for gathering evidence, the officials said, adding that further details were awaited.

The officials said police is investigating all possible angles, including suicide, behind the deaths of the two youngsters.
